Dr. Nguyen is studying how amount of sleep influences mood for kindergarteners. A sample of 100 children is selected. Fifty children are allowed to sleep for 11 hours each night. The other 50 children are awoken after 8 hours. After three nights, Dr. Nguyen records the mood for each child and compares the two groups of scores. In this example, how many levels are there for the independent variable?

Answer:

The answer is 2 levels

Step-by-step explanation:

There are two levels in this case because the experiment in question here compares how two sleep levels, which can be said to be the experimental sleep level of 11 hours, and the control sleep level of 8 hours. Basically the type of treatment provided in the question has two levels: control and experimental. This entails that if an experiment was designed to compare 4 types of meal, then such experiment can be said to have 4 levels of independent variables.
